Convert Images to WebP Online
WebP is a modern image format developed by Google that provides significantly better compression than JPEG and PNG — typically 25–35% smaller at equivalent visual quality. Converting your images to WebP reduces page load times, saves bandwidth, and improves Core Web Vitals scores for websites. This tool converts PNG, JPEG, GIF, and BMP images to WebP directly in your browser, supporting both lossy and lossless WebP output. You can adjust quality to find the right balance between file size and visual fidelity. WebP is now supported by all major browsers, making it the recommended format for web images in 2024 and beyond.
FAQ
- How much smaller is WebP compared to JPEG or PNG?
- WebP lossy images are typically 25–35% smaller than equivalent JPEG files. WebP lossless images are typically 26% smaller than PNG. The exact saving depends on image content.
- Is WebP supported in all browsers?
- Yes. WebP is supported in Chrome, Firefox, Safari (since v14), Edge, and Opera. It covers over 96% of global browser usage.
- Should I use lossy or lossless WebP?
- Use lossy WebP for photographs — it gives the best compression. Use lossless WebP for graphics, illustrations, logos, or images with text where every pixel matters.
